  6. Gliwice is the westernmost town of the GOP (Upper Silesia Industrial Centre), an agglomeration of several towns that includes Katowice. Gliwice is located in the southern Poland voivodship of Silesia. Geographically, Gliwice lies on the Katowice Upland and is bisected by the Klodnica River.
